-
Biggest barracuda ever caught
by Pablo Koch-Schick
Today, we embark on an exhilarating journey to explore one of the ocean's most fearsome predators - the barracuda. Known for its powerful speed, sh...
Use left/right arrows to navigate the slideshow or swipe left/right if using a mobile device